Tuvan shamans participate in a ritual called "Kamlanie" outside the Kyzyl town, the administrative centre of Russia's Tuva region, some 800 km (497 miles) south of Siberian city of Krasnoyarsk, September 13, 2011. Eight shamans, members of "The Spirit of Bear" society took part in the traditional ritual. Tuvans, one of Asian nomadic peoples, practise two main religions - Buddhism and Shamanism.
